Another very warm and sunny day. Temp' close to 30c today.
A bit hot to work so just pottered about today. Some good wildlife activity to watch.
Ragwort still doing well in my wild flower patch. Southern hawkers emerging again, two today. Takes me over 30 now I have seen, how many in total I wonder?
Comma butterflies and speckled wood all over the garden today. I spot many more, whites, blues, yellows, wish I could catch and identify.
Swifts were very busy today, a group of six about most of the day. In fact just heard them again now at 8.30pm.
